A Postgraduate Certificate in Industrial IoT (IIoT) equips professionals with the advanced skills and knowledge necessary to design, implement, and manage IIoT systems within industrial settings. This specialized program focuses on practical application, bridging the gap between theoretical understanding and real-world challenges.
Learning outcomes typically include a comprehensive understanding of IIoT architectures, data analytics for industrial applications, cybersecurity protocols specific to industrial environments, and the deployment of various IIoT technologies, such as cloud platforms and edge computing. Students develop proficiency in using relevant software and hardware for smart manufacturing and predictive maintenance strategies.
The duration of a Postgraduate Certificate in Industrial IoT varies depending on the institution, but generally ranges from six months to one year, often delivered through part-time or online learning formats to accommodate working professionals.
